    IMO: Bodog is okay for the casual sports bettor, but if one is serious about it like most of us are on this site, I wouldn't use it as a primary book. Juice is much higher there, and they don't let you buy off key #'s, or let you but pts when the line isn't flat (which is all the time with them). They also circle a ton of games.

    There lines are almost always a tad higher, so they are best used as an out if there is a dog you love.

    They are lightening quick with payouts, and loaded with cash so your money is secure and you won't get screwed. You can also wager over the phone which is nice.

                          I would caution folks that Bodog owner Calvin Eyre cancelled a trip to the U.S. shortly after the Millenium/BetOnSports indictment and shutdown. It was while making a U.S. connection that the BoS exec was arrested and the company shut down. The fact that Eyre is afraid to come to the U.S. should be cautionary.

                          I personally wouldn't have a penny in Bodog for this reason.
